Program: Speech Pathology Dysphagia Clinic (Progression)
Organizations: William Osler Health System - Brampton Civic Hospital
     Outpatient Rehabilitation
    
Description of Services: Swallowing assessment and follow-up services for adults who have or are suspected of having swallowing difficulties, and are at risk of aspiration pneumonia, dehydration, and malnutrition

Conditions treated:

Dysphagia (difficulty swallowing) with or without the following complications:
  • Aspiration
  • Pneumonia
  • Dehydration
  • Malnutrition
